Output df64e0aebe203b33c40698e6d7af2e8c5b80489bcbc0fc1daf8d4760d5db2634:0

value
14450300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368247fc97c7536ecd4c52b9edbcffdd003b0072 OP_EQUAL
address
36fEUzteYKBmvKCUtFMFtCNTXP4zmkm5r6
transaction
df64e0aebe203b33c40698e6d7af2e8c5b80489bcbc0fc1daf8d4760d5db2634
confirmations
398704
spent
true